Triumph Street Triple RS 2020 India Launch On March 25: Details
Triumph India is gearing up to launch the all-new Street Triple RS on March 25, 2020. The new Street Triple RS features a host of changes over the previous model. The upcoming naked motorcycle from the brand features a few segment-first features as well.
The 2020 Street Triple RS features a more evolved design as compared to the previous model. The LED tail-lamp with integrated DRLs are sharper and more aggressive on the upcoming motorcycle. The belly pan and tail section panels have also been revised and make the motorcycle stand apart.
Other changes include a revised large TFT screen similar to the one featured on the older models. However, the new instrument cluster includes new graphics, Bluetooth smartphone connectivity, and an accessory chip for enabling GoPro controls.
The biggest update on the 2020 Triumph Street Triple RS is the engine. The 765cc, liquid-cooled, three-cylinder engine now produces a maximum power of 121bhp @11,750rpm and a peak torque of 79Nm at 9,350rpm - a 2Nm increase from the previous model's 77Nm. The engine comes paired to a six-speed gearbox with a two-way quick-shifter for clutchless up and downshifts.
The 2020 Street Triple RS will continue to feature twin-spar aluminium frame from the older model. The braking duties are handled by Brembo Twin 310mm floating discs with Brembo M50 monobloc callipers at the front and Single 220mm disc with Brembo single-piston calliper setup at the rear.
The suspension on the 2020 Street Triple RS has been carried forward from the older model. This includes 41mm Showa UpSide-Down forks at the front, and Ohlins STX40 mono-shock suspension unit at the rear, both of which are fully adjustable for compression and rebound damping with preload adjustment. The new model comes equipped with 17-inch alloy wheels at both ends shod with Pirelli Supercorsa SP V3 tyres, offering maximum grip and high-speed stability.
The Street Triple RS comes loaded with a host of rider aids. These include four riding modes with one rider configurable mode, traction control, dual-channel ABS and a host of other features enabled by an accessory chip offered as an add-on by the company.
The previous-generation Triumph Street Triple RS is priced at Rs 11.13 lakh ex-showroom (Delhi). We expect the company to price the new-generation Street Triple RS in a similar pricing bracket in India.
Thoughts About The Triumph Street Triple RS 2020 India Launch On March 25
The Street Triple has always been an iconic naked motorcycle in the country. The motorcycle with its triple-cylinder engine and a throaty exhaust have always made the streets of India sound better. We expect no less from the upcoming motorcycle as it still retains the essence of the previous generation models. With all the new technology and features, pricing will be a key factor for the sales numbers.
